Abstract:
This paper first examines the existing approaches to task planning and resources allocation in the cloud infrastructure and evaluates their advantages and disadvantages. Subsequently, a hybrid algorithm (Fuzzy-PSO) is presented to allocate tasks to resources and reduce runtime. In this research, the optimal particle swarm algorithm for scheduling tasks between data centers is used which has shown great success in solving continuous optimization problems. Fuzzy logic is also used to determine the competence of nodes in this algorithm. This algorithm assigns tasks to processing resources in a way that the workload is distributed evenly over the processing resources to maximize the efficiency of available processing resources and minimize runtime and total cost.
